Getting Around

Getting around Sandakan is quite straightforward. For longer distances or reaching attractions outside the town center like Sepilok, taxis are readily available and relatively affordable. Grab, a popular ride-hailing app, also operates in Sandakan and offers a convenient option. For exploring the immediate town area, walking is a good choice. Local buses and minibuses also connect different parts of Sandakan, providing a budget-friendly way to navigate, though they can be a bit more time-consuming. Renting a car is also an option for those seeking more flexibility, especially if planning extensive exploration of the surrounding regions.

Must-See Attractions

  • Visit the world-renowned Sepilok Orangutan Rehabilitation Centre in Sandakan to see rescued orangutans up close during feeding times.
  • Embark on a river cruise along the Kinabatangan River, Sabah's longest river, spotting proboscis monkeys, pygmy elephants, and diverse birdlife near Sandakan.
  • Explore the Sandakan Memorial Park, a poignant tribute to the Allied prisoners of war who suffered during WWII, offering a glimpse into history.
  • Wander through the vibrant Sandakan Central Market, a bustling hub to sample local fruits, fresh seafood, and handicrafts while interacting with locals.
  • Trek through the mystical rainforests of the nearby Gomantong Caves, home to millions of bats and swiftlets, a truly unique natural spectacle near Sandakan.
  • Discover the Agnes Keith House in Sandakan, a historic colonial bungalow offering panoramic views and insight into the life of a renowned author.
